Train Options from Guildford to Liphook
Type | company | departure station | arrival station | departure time | arrival time | Frequency | Duration | Price Range | layover city |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Direct | South Western Railway | Guildford, Guildford | Liphook, Liphook | 09:00, 10:00, 11:00, 12:00, 13:00, 14:00, 15:00, 16:00, 17:00, 18:00 | 09:26, 10:26, 11:26, 12:26, 13:26, 14:26, 15:26, 16:26, 17:26, 18:26 | Every hour | 26m | £ 7.8-18 | |
Connecting | South Western Railway | Guildford, Guildford | Liphook, Liphook | 09:06, 10:06, 11:06, 12:06, 13:06, 14:06, 15:06, 16:06, 17:06, 18:06 | 09:53, 10:53, 11:53, 12:53, 13:53, 14:53, 15:53, 16:53, 17:53, 18:53 | Every hour | 47m | £ 7.8-18 | Petersfield |
Connecting | South Western Railway | Guildford, Guildford | Liphook, Liphook | 09:20, 10:20, 11:20, 12:20, 13:20, 14:20, 15:20, 16:20, 17:20, 18:20 | 09:56, 10:56, 11:56, 12:56, 13:56, 14:56, 15:56, 16:56, 17:56, 18:56 | Every hour | 36m | £ 7.8-18 | Haslemere |

Travel Tips
⛰ Enjoy the Scenic Views
The train journey from Guildford to Liphook is dotted with beautiful countryside scenery. Keep an eye out for the rolling hills and picturesque farmland as you travel, particularly as you approach the South Downs.
📍 Check Out Local Festivals
Depending on the time of year, you might catch local festivals in Liphook or Guildford. Plan your trip around events like the Guildford Summer Festival or Liphook Carnival to enhance your travel experience.
🚍 Utilize the Train’s Amenities
The trains on this route may offer onboard Wi-Fi, power outlets, and refreshment services. Bring your device fully charged, and consider downloading some local history or podcasts about the area.
🎭 Mind the Local Etiquette
When traveling, it's courteous to offer your seat to elderly passengers or those with disabilities. Also, keep noise to a minimum, as many train passengers prefer a quiet journey.
🏛 Explore Stopovers
If your schedule allows, consider planning a brief stop at Haslemere or Godalming. Both towns feature charming shops and cafes worth exploring, providing a deeper experience of the region.
